Huge Argentina Explosion Injures 20, Filmed from Plane
Argentina industrial explosion injures over 20

A dramatic video captured from a passenger plane shows the moment a huge explosion ripped through an industrial park in Argentina, sending a massive plume of smoke into the sky.

Explosion Rocks Petrochemical Complex

The powerful blast occurred on Saturday, 15 November, at an industrial complex in the area of Carlos Spegazzini in Argentina's Buenos Aires province. The location is known for its petrochemical operations.

The force of the explosion and the subsequent large fire resulted in over 20 injuries and caused significant damage to several buildings within the complex.

Firefighting Efforts and Scale of the Blaze

The inferno generated enormous clouds of smoke that were visible from the air, with a passenger on an aeroplane filming the dramatic scene. Dozens of fire crews were urgently deployed to the site to battle the blaze and prevent it from spreading further.

The scale of the incident was such that the towering column of smoke served as a stark visual marker of the destruction below, highlighting the severity of the industrial accident.

Proximity to Major Airport

Adding to the concern was the industrial complex's location, situated approximately 15 kilometres from Ezeiza Airport, a major international gateway to Argentina. The proximity to a key transport hub underscores the potential risks associated with industrial operations near populated and critical infrastructure areas.

Authorities are now focused on controlling the fire and treating the injured while an investigation into the cause of the explosion is expected to begin.
